By Amaechi Agbo

The federal government has inaugurated a technical committee to streamline the existing sorghum varieties and meet food, industrial and export demands in the country.

The Permanent Secretary of the Federal Ministry of Agriculture and Rural Development, Dr Ernest Umakhihe, inaugurated the committee in Abuja on Sunday.

Represented by the Director, Federal Department of Agriculture ( FDA), Mrs Karima Babangida, Mr Umakhihe noted that the ministry has been promoting sorghum production and value addition towards self-sufficiency and meeting industrial requirements.

 Nigeria currently ranks 2nd highest sorghum producer in Africa. 

Speaking at the event held at the Ministry’s Conference Hall, the Permanent Secretary tasked stakeholders in the value chain such as  farmers, seed producers and input providers to collaborate in order to achieve set target and become the very highest producer as well as beef up for export and generate revenue for the nation.
